If you still have burned on bits of food left on your pizza stone, make a cleaning paste using baking soda and water. Place some baking soda in a small dish and add a little water, then mix together.

Web18 nov. 2024 · The pizza stone can be cleaned and rinsed entirely with water. With a clean sponge, wipe away any remaining food or grime using only water. Do not try to remove oils that build up — it is fully unnecessary. Leaving the oils on the stone actually helps season the stone, turning it into a slicker, more easy-to-use item. photography mini session ideas https://lcfyb.com

WebOnce you receive your new pizza stone, it is wise to remove the protective oil coating on the stone that was applied during manufacturing. This can be accomplished by washing with mild soap and warm water, then rinsing thoroughly. Scrub pizza stone for seasoning Give the stone a scrubbing if needed to remove any dust or debris from its package. WebGently press a clean sponge dampened with water to the oil affected area. Apply the cornstarch poultice to the area with plastic spatula or spoon. Cover with plastic wrap and press firmly. Poke holes in the plastic wrap with a toothpick or fork. Allow the poultice to dry, which may take 24 to 48 hours. Once dry, remove and discard the plastic ... Web8 apr. 2024 · To remove oil stains from a pizza stone, try the baking powder method. Apply a baking powder and water solution on the grease stains and scrub using an old toothbrush until the stains disappear.
